just got back from pella studios this week .it was the first time we had been with kosmar, the reps were fine.no problems with flight and the studios were fine.the air con was payed direct to pella.the safety deposit boxes were down by the bar.the rooms and pool were lovely and clean. 100 mtrs down pedestrianised walkway to beach and bars,etc.the owners stayed by complex and were so well thought of that we met people who ONLY go to pella studios and had become friends.
it is down 80 mtrs away from the main road so you have to walk your cases down after being dropped off and take them back up when coming home.could not fault apartments and owners,well worth taking a chance with

We stayed for a week at Pella at the end of august - could not fault them - Theo and his family were very friendly and nothing was ever too much trouble for them. They are the cleanest rooms we have ever stayed in either on Greece mainland or the islands.
I would highly recommend Pella House - as for Kosmar we never needed their services so could not comment on their customer care - I understand they were at Pella when stated on the noticeboard and they kept us informed of flight times etc and were on time for pick up.
Our friends stayed at Ammon Gardens and whilst the complex was nice the rooms were dark and the self catering facilities were awful everything to s/c with was stashed away in a cupboard - at least at Pella there was a full kitchen area with table and chair to sit at - however you didnt need to sit indoors as it was so peacful sitting outside on the balcony.
Pella is centrally situated a hop skip and a jump and you were on the beach and amongst all the tavernas for the evening. Up the road the other way were supermarkets and a fantastic bakery for fresh morning croissants and custard pies to die for!!! The old square was only a five minute walk away - we spent a few lunchtimes in the Greek bar just wiling away the hours with local wine and food - fantastic
If you fancy it I say book it and try - I dont think you will be dissappointed.
Tracey
